Handover note — Crumbwheel order cutoffs.

Welcome aboard. The bakery cutoff rule in Crumbwheel closes same-day orders at 14:00 local to each storefront, not UTC — this has bitten us twice. Holiday overrides live in the calendar service and take precedence silently, so always check there first when a cutoff looks wrong. To unlock the calendar service's admin console after a restart, enter the recovery passphrase below.

vault phrase of bagap-bahaf = silion-pelox-sorox-casdor-quenwyn-fraax-eliox-praael-kelion-quenvan-kasox-rusael-norius-belvan

As release manager for the Thornbeck platform, you own the Quillbus broker upgrade window. The process is straightforward: drain consumers, snapshot the queue metadata, roll nodes one at a time, and verify replication lag returns to zero before re-enabling producers. Upgrades happen on alternating Tuesdays. The snapshot archive is encrypted, and restoring it during a failed rollout requires the recovery passphrase noted below.

strongbox words: fraath-isteth

Downstream consumers at Brightmoor Payroll Services have confirmed compatibility, but any release cut before the 4.2 tag must ship the legacy formatter behind the `payroll.legacy_export` flag. Verify the export checksum against the manifest before tagging, and document the format version in the release notes. All export bundles must be signed before upload to the distribution bucket. Use the following key for signing:

rollout seal: bky4_x7Gc

TURN-208: Gatevale turnstile counters at the Merrow Field pilot double-count when a rotation reverses mid-cycle. Attendance totals drift roughly 2% high per event. The debounce window fix is implemented, reviewed by Ilsa, and soak-tested across two simulated match days without drift. Ready for your cut; the candidate build is identified below.

trace token, tagag-tafog: htk6_5ed18c